11.02.2014 Views

UML PROFILE FOR SAVECCM - Research

UML PROFILE FOR SAVECCM - Research

UML PROFILE FOR SAVECCM - Research

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

References<br />

References<br />

[Åkerholm 05] Åkerholm, M.; Möller, A.; Hansson, H.; Nolin, M.: "Towards a dependable<br />

component technology for embedded system applications", 10 th IEEE International<br />

Workshop on Object – Oriented Real – Time Dependable System, 2005.<br />

[Åkerholm 07] Åkerholm, M. et al: "The Save approach to component – based development of<br />

vehicular systems", The Journal of Systems and Software 80 (2007)<br />

[Bass 98]<br />

[Booch 93]<br />

Bass, L.; Clements, P.; Kazman, R; Software Architecture in practice, Boston, MA.:<br />

Addison – Wesley, March 1998<br />

Booch, G.: Software components with Ada: Structure, Tools and Subsystems, 3 rd<br />

ed., Reading, MA: Addison – Wesley, 1993.<br />

[Crnković 02] Crnković, I.; Larsson, M.: Building Reliable Component – Based Software systems,<br />

Artech House, 2002.<br />

[Gao 03]<br />

Gao, J.; Tsao, J.; Wu, Y.: "Testing and Quality Assurance for Component – Based<br />

Software", Boston: Artech House, 2003.<br />

[Hansson 04] Hansson, H.; Åkerholm, M.; Crnkovic, I.; Törngren, M.: "SaveCCM – a component<br />

model for safety-critical real-time systems", Proceedings of 30 th Euromicro<br />

Conference, Special Session Component Models for Dependable Systems, 2004.<br />

[Lüders 06] Lüders, F.: "An evolutionary approach to software components in embedded real –<br />

time systems", Dissertation, Mälardalen University, Västerås, Sweden, 2006.<br />

[Meyer 92] Meyer, B: "Applying 'Design by contract'", IEEE Computer 25, 10, October 1992<br />

[Meyer 97]<br />

Meyer, B.: Object – Oriented Software Construction, 2 nd ed., London, UK: Prentice-<br />

Hall International, 1997.<br />

[OCLs 06] OMG: Object Constraint Language Specification, version 2.0, May 2006.<br />

[SaveD 07] Monot, A.; Noyrit, F.: SaveIDE – Developer Documentation, October, 2007.<br />

[SaveR 07]<br />

[Selic 07]<br />

Håkansson, J.: The SaveCCM Language Reference Manual<br />

Selic, B.: "A Systematic Approach to Domain-Specific Language Design Using<br />

<strong>UML</strong>", 10th IEEE International Symposium on Object and Component-Oriented<br />

Real-Time Distributed Computing, 2007.<br />

[SPdes 08] Save<strong>UML</strong> project: Save<strong>UML</strong> Design description, version 1.1, January 2008.<br />

[SPfin 08] Save<strong>UML</strong> project: Save<strong>UML</strong> project Final presentation, January 2008.<br />

[SPprof 08] Save<strong>UML</strong> project: Save<strong>UML</strong> profile specification, version 1.0, January 2008.<br />

[SPusr 08] Save<strong>UML</strong> project: Save<strong>UML</strong> Users manual, version 1.0, January 2008.<br />

[SUo 07] Save<strong>UML</strong> project: Overview of the <strong>UML</strong> Component diagram, 2007.<br />

[SunEJB 05]<br />

Sun Microsystems: Enterprise JavaBeans Specification, Version 3.0 Final Release,<br />

2005.<br />

[Szyperski 99] Szyperski, C.: Component Software – Beyond Object-Oriented Programming,<br />

Reading, MA: Addison – Wesley, 1999.<br />

[<strong>UML</strong>i 07] OMG: Unified Modeling Language Infrastructure Specification, Version 2.1.1,<br />

February 2007.<br />

79

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!